Problem: I have a laptop with a PCMCIA-GPIB card installed and I am trying to see it in the Measurement & Automation Explorer (MAX) of a desktop PC with a PCI-GPIB card in it. I would also like to see the desktop PC from the MAX on the laptop. Is this possible? Solution: In order to do this, you must connect the PCI-GPIB card of the desktop to the PCMCIA-GPIB card of the laptop, Once the devices are connected with the GPIB cable, in order to get each device to recognize each other’s address, enable the system controller mode on the laptop and desktop as well. With both computers running MAX, open the following on each PC:
On the desktop PC: Select Tools » NI-VISA » VISA Interactive control while in the VISA I/O tab - Expand GPIBX (PCI-GPIB) (under my computer) - Double-click on GPIBX::INTFC On the laptop: Select Tools » NI-VISA » VISA Interactive control while in the VISA I/O tab - Expand GPIBY (PCMCIA-GPIB) (under my computer) - Double-click on GPIBY::INTFC Keep both of these windows open and do not modify anything. On the desktop: Click on Scan for Instruments (address should be recognized) On the laptop: Click on Scan for Instruments (address should be recognized) See the Related Links section below for an additional method to communicate between two PCs using GPIB.
